Cob Cottage

Romantic 1 bedroom self catering Cottage, R980 per night, Bedding and towels provided.

The Cob Cottage lies in the valley against the cliffs on the far side of the valley and is tucked away and very private. It has a queen sized bed and very comfortable lounge.  The open plan kitchen is fully equipped with gas appliances for self catering guests.  There is a delightful rustic bathroom, half open to the sky, so you can lie in the bath and watch the eagles and stars overhead. There is solar power in the cottage for lights or you can use the paraffin lamps provided.

Please note that as we are in a World Heritage Site, we are unable to accommodate pets.

Check in is anytime from 2pm onwards, and check out by 10am. Guests are welcome to arrive earlier and leave later if you want to do walks, however please ensure you are out of your accommodation so that our team can start cleaning for the next guests.  Please note this is un-serviced accommodation, though for stays of four days or more we will organise to have the cottage cleaned and new linen and towels provided.Please make sure that you arrange this when you make your booking and before your arrival.
